Ciclo sobre colores mientras graficamos en MATLAB

Cuando trazo varias curvas en la misma parcela usandohold on, cada curva por defecto es del mismo color (azul). Me gustaría que tuvieran todos los colores diferentes.

Una solución que he visto es hacer un vector de color, por ej.c = ['k', 'g', 'r', ...] y recorrerlo, pero no me gusta esta solución. Las cosas se romperán si mi número de parcelas es mayor que la longitud de mi vector de colorc, y no quiero tener que definirc en cada archivo

¿Hay una solución mejor?

Respuestas a la pregunta(2)

Su respuesta a la pregunta